Chinese Zodiac Sign Chart
Zodiac Animal | Chinese Name | Recent Years |
---|---|---|
Rat | 鼠 (shǔ) | 1924, 1936, 1948, 1960, 1972, 1984, 1996, 2008, 2020, 2032 |
Ox | 牛 (niú) | 1925, 1937, 1949, 1961, 1973, 1985, 1997, 2009, 2021, 2033 |
Tiger | 虎 (hǔ) | 1926, 1938, 1950, 1962, 1974, 1986, 1998, 2010, 2022, 2034 |
Rabbit | 兔 (tù) | 1927, 1939, 1951, 1963, 1975, 1987, 1999, 2011, 2023, 2035 |
Dragon | 龙 (lóng) | 1928, 1940, 1952, 1964, 1976, 1988, 2000, 2012, 2024, 2036 |
Snake | 蛇 (shé) | 1929, 1941, 1953, 1965, 1977, 1989, 2001, 2013, 2025, 2037 |
Horse | 马 (mǎ) | 1930, 1942, 1954, 1966, 1978, 1990, 2002, 2014, 2026, 2038 |
Sheep | 羊 (yáng) | 1931, 1943, 1955, 1967, 1979, 1991, 2003, 2015, 2027, 2039 |
Monkey | 猴 (hóu) | 1932, 1944, 1956, 1968, 1980, 1992, 2004, 2016, 2028, 2040 |
Rooster | 鸡 (jī) | 1933, 1945, 1957, 1969, 1981, 1993, 2005, 2017, 2029, 2041 |
Dog | 狗 (gǒu) | 1934, 1946, 1958, 1970, 1982, 1994, 2006, 2018, 2030, 2042 |
Pig | 猪 (zhū) | 1935, 1947, 1959, 1971, 1983, 1995, 2007, 2019, 2031, 2043 |
In ancient times, in order to tell the time, people divided a day into twelve 2-hour periods, and designated an animal to represent each period, according to each animal's “special time, according to an ancient mnemonic and common observations.
Zodiac animal | Hours | Mnemonic | Observation |
---|---|---|---|
Rat | 11pm-1am | Rats forage most actively. | The ancients heard them at this hour. |
Ox | 1-3am | Oxen chew the cud most comfortably. | People of old would get up and feed them at this time. |
Tiger | 3-5am | Tigers hunt most ferociously. | Chinese people long ago often hear them roaring at this time. |
Rabbit | 5-7am | Rabbits pound the ground most fervently. | Rabbits were seen to come out of their holes to eat grass with dew at dawn. |
Dragon | 7-9am | Dragons hover most thickly. | Morning mists, particularly coils around hills, made people think of dragons. |
Snake | 9-11am | Snakes emerge most readily. | Snakes come out to sun themselves as the morning sun warms the ground. |
Horse | 11am-1pm | Horses stand most impressively. | When the sun is strongest, only horses were seen standing, while most other animals would lie down to rest. |
Goat | 1-3pm | Goats eat and urinate most frequently. | This was reputedly the best time to herd goats, when the sun had dried the dew on the undergrowth. |
Monkey | 3-5pm | Monkeys play most vigorously. | Monkeys were seen and heard playing and calling in the trees at this time. |
Rooster | 5-7pm | Roosters return to their coops most routinely. | Roosters are routinely led back to their henhouses before sunset. |
Dog | 7-9pm | Dogs guard most dutifully. | People would take their dogs out to keep a watch at night before sleep. |
Pig | 9-11pm | Pigs snuffle most sweetly. | As they settled down to sleep, people heard pigs snouting their troughs. |
